Auto Power Lock Repair - How to Fix a Faulty Actuator

When it comes to repair of the auto power lock there are several steps to follow. First, you need to determine the problem. Auto power locks can fail due to a variety of reasons. If you suspect that there is a wiring issue take a look at the battery voltage and connect the test light to it. Then replace the actuator.

Possible causes of a defective door lock actuator

A malfunctioning door lock actuator is a common issue. It is essential to know the root of the issue so that you can correct it. Several potential causes of the actuator of a door lock that is damaged include oil, corrosion dust, and debris. These materials can get into the mechanical links and react with moisture, causing corrosion, which in turn weakens them.

If the door lock isn't opening or closing properly, check the power supply to it. The actuator is connected to the door panel's primary power output through wires. If these wires become damaged or the door panel becomes loose and the door car central Locking repair near me locking system will cease to function. This issue can be resolved easily.

The entry of water into the door lock actuator can also be an issue. Water can enter the door and trigger the anti-theft alarm. To solve this issue, you can either replace the door lock actuator or cover the connector with a seal.

To replace the door lock actuator, you need to remove the door panel. Then, loosen the screws that connect to the actuator. Be careful not to damage the cables when you pull out the panel. Connect the cables once more and wait for the sound to click. If you hear the same click sound when manually unlocking and locking the door of the driver the door lock actuator is receiving the power. If not, the problem is in the grounding system.

The most common symptoms of a malfunctioning door lock actuator is an inability to lock doors with the power lock. You might still be able to unlock the doors with the use of a key, button or keyfob, but you'll be required to manually unlock the doors. The doors will not lock completely or intermittently if there's an actuator that is weak.

The door lock actuator, an electrically powered device, transmits an alert to the power door lock. The door locking system powered by power won't operate properly without this device, making the car lock repair near me inoperable.

How do you troubleshoot a malfunctioning door lock actuator

There are many things you can do if your door lock isn't functioning correctly. First, look to determine whether the actuator is damaged or jammed. Also, examine the child safety lock. If the lock does not operate properly, you may need to replace the actuator.

The actuator can be difficult to reach. You can try applying 12 V to it with jumper wires, or with a Power Probe. Alternately, you can dismantle the door to look for a damaged line. Broken lines indicate that the door lock actuator isn't receiving the electrical current it needs.

A malfunctioning door lock actuator could be an issue that is common and can be difficult to determine if it is the door lock actuator itself. If it's the door lock mechanism, you could have to examine the other components, too. If they are working properly, it should be easy to replace the door lock actuator. In many instances, a malfunctioning door lock actuator may be an indication of a more serious issue.

It is recommended that you have the door lock actuator replaced by a mechanic when it's damaged. The repair can cost up to $120 or more, car central locking repair near Me according to the type of actuator. If you can look up OEM parts, you might be able to find them at a reasonable price. You might need to purchase an aftermarket component if you cannot locate the part you require. But, it is important to note that these aren't universal and are likely to not fit your mobile car lock repair.

A bad door lock actuator can stop a door lock from working as it should. It could cause the lock's behaviour to change. It might also make noises while operating. In some instances the door lock might be operable, but it may not be responsive or work intermittently.

Replacing a broken door lock actuator

Replacing a faulty door lock controller is an easy auto power lock repair you can perform yourself. To accomplish this, you'll need to take out the door panel. It's important to do so without damaging the door. Then, you should examine the lock system assembly to determine what's wrong.

First, determine if the actuator is malfunctioning. This could cause the door lock mechanism to stop working and your car ignition lock repair won't lock. Although this isn't a danger however, it could cause more trouble. To fix the issue remove the door's panel and look at the mechanism of the lock.

Next, locate the actuator. In many cars, it's attached to the door latch assembly with screws or plastic clips. To remove the actuator, you'll need mirrors and curved picks. You might have an older actuator.

If your car has an electric door lock, the problem is most likely to be a malfunctioning door lock actuator or switch. To determine if the problem is due to the actuator's power supply is to be checked, you can do a test. To access the actuator, one must take off the door panel. Safety glasses are recommended.

Once you've discovered the issue with the door lock actuator, you'll need to decide if you require replacing it. Although it'll cost more but it will make your vehicle more convenient. Jumper wires can be used to supply 12 volts to the actuator to verify its power source.

It is possible that you have a damaged door lock actuator if you have noticed unusual noises coming emanating from your home's door. The actuator is controlled by a sequence of gears, as well as an electric motor. If one of these components fails, it could be an indication of a larger issue. Broken door lock actuators could indicate that the motor and gears are worn out or damaged. You should replace the actuator right away if you suspect that it's malfunctioning.
